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Lewis Run

The walk-in tub market in and around Lewis Run, PA, is characterized by a small number of highly specialized local and regional contractors rather than a high volume of competition. The quality of service is generally high, as these businesses have built their reputation on serving the specific needs of the senior population in McKean County and the surrounding rural communities. Due to the specialized nature of the work and the cost of the products, pricing is typically at a premium. A complete walk-in tub installation, including the tub unit and professional installation, generally ranges from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, with the final cost heavily dependent on the tub's features (e.g., hydrotherapy jets, quick-drain technology) and the extent of any necessary bathroom remodeling. Customers are advised to seek multiple in-home quotes and verify state licensing and insurance for any provider.

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Lewis Run

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Lewis Run, Pennsylvania.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Lewis Run, and are there any Pennsylvania-specific financial assistance programs?

In the Lewis Run and McKean County area, a complete walk-in tub purchase and professional install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the model's features (jets, heater, door type). It's important for Pennsylvania homeowners to budget for potential plumbing modifications common in older homes. You may explore assistance through Pennsylvania's Act 150 OPTIONS program for older adults or local Area Agency on Aging resources for potential grants or low-interest loans to offset costs.

2How long does a full walk-in tub installation take for a Lewis Run homeowner, and are there seasonal timing considerations?

A professional installation usually takes 1 to 3 days, depending on the complexity and any needed bathroom modifications. Given Lewis Run's cold winters and potential for heavy snowfall, scheduling installation in late spring, summer, or early fall is often advisable. This avoids delays with material deliveries and ensures contractors can properly manage water shut-offs without risking frozen pipes, which is a key regional consideration.

3Are there specific local permits or regulations in Lewis Run or Pennsylvania I need to be aware of for walk-in tub installation?

Yes, most installations in Lewis Run will require a plumbing permit from the local borough office or McKean County. Pennsylvania's Uniform Construction Code (UCC) applies, and your licensed contractor should handle this. A critical local consideration is ensuring your home's water heater capacity is sufficient for the tub's fill volume, especially in older homes, to provide a safe and comfortable warm soak.

4What should I look for when choosing a local walk-in tub service provider in the Lewis Run/Bradford area?

Prioritize providers licensed, insured, and experienced with installations in older housing stock common to the region. Look for established local or regional companies with physical showrooms you can visit. Always check for Pennsylvania-specific references and read reviews focusing on post-installation service, as you'll want reliable local support for any future maintenance, especially during winter months.

5I'm concerned about slipping and the tub retaining heat. Are walk-in tubs safe and comfortable in our climate?

Modern walk-in tubs are designed for safety with built-in low-threshold doors, grab bars, and non-slip floors. For comfort in Pennsylvania's climate, look for models with rapid-fill faucets and built-in water heaters or inline heaters to maintain temperature during a longer fill time. High-quality insulation in the tub walls is also crucial to keep water warm throughout your bath, making it a cozy retreat during our cold seasons.
